Fashion / IncomingAnother Magazine Launches its New Issue in NYJefferson Hack brings the Stephen Petronio Company to Dustin Yellin's studio.ShareLink copied ✔️September 8, 2008FashionIncomingAnother Magazine Launches its New Issue in NY AnOther Magazine, in association with Bamford, hosted a unique launch party for its fifteenth issue at artist Dustin Yellin's studio in Brooklyn, to kick off New York Fashion week. Despite the tail end of Hurricane Hanna and a deluge of rain outside, a cool and relaxed crowd turned up, including Mark Ronson, Terry Richardson, Veruschka, Jacquetta Wheeler, the Misshapes, Tara Subkoff, Anouck Lepere, and Amy Sacco. Surrounded by Dustin's incredible sculptures; 3-D skulls, guns and objects trapped in blocks of clear resin, the spacious studio was transformed into a Vaudevillian style theatre, the Stephen Petronio Company took to the stage to awe the crowd with a beautiful and sensuous performance. After feasting on delicious organic fare by Cleaver, accompanied by Moet Champagne and cocktails, The Misshapes and Jefferson cranked up the music. Anouck Lepere was first on the dancefloor, followed by an unusually animated crowd of London and New York's artists, fashionistas and cool kids.
